What we believe
A useful decision tool should be simple by default. You should be able to open the page, add your choices, and spin without creating an account or learning a complicated workflow.
The selection should also be easy to understand. WheelGo keeps the available choices visible on the wheel, and equally sized segments give each current entry the same chance.
Privacy matters too. Wheel entries and preferences are stored in your browser, so the information used by the editor stays on your device.
